Output 3fa18e26b95827fb9051452ec73781530b62aa9d0e69b01741c8d0eb3f587ddf:76

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 27c8a139f5dbdb503a4e42fc8cf54589042e13e7
address
tb1qyly2zw04m0d4qwjwgt7gea293yzzuyl8nzflu5
transaction
3fa18e26b95827fb9051452ec73781530b62aa9d0e69b01741c8d0eb3f587ddf